Literatura infantil e ideología: propuesta de análisis

2009

Tras unas breves consideraciones introductorias en torno al concepto de ideología, el artículo analiza la aportación que la crítica postcolonial contemporánea ha realizado al análisis del aspecto representacional de los textos literarios y a la lectura de los valores (políticos, literarios, morales) que éstos denotan. Tras una breve referencia a los autores y a las obras más representativas de esta corriente crítica, se analiza la importancia que el estudio de la hibridación de lenguas tiene para el estudio de la ideología. Ejemplos extraídos de la obra de Bernardo Atxaga y pautas para el análisis de la ideología de los textos artísticos completan el artículo.

LA EVALUACIÓN DEL CYBERBULLYING: SITUACIÓN ACTUAL Y RETOS FUTUROS

2016

En la última década se ha asistido a un notable incremento del interés de la comunidad educativa y científica por el cyberbullying, una nueva forma de maltrato e intimidación entre iguales. A pesar de la amplia proliferación de estudios y de instrumentos de evaluación sobre el fenómeno, siguen existiendo importantes lagunas conceptuales y metodológicas. Este trabajo ofrece una revisión general y actualizada de los resultados de la investigación sobre la definición del constructo, su prevalencia y su impacto en las personas implicadas. ”En ny hverdag”. Mødres opplevelse av hverdagen med et prematurt barn, og støtten ved en ressurshelsestasjon

2015

The study explores mothers’ of premature infants experience of how health centers especially adapted for families with premature infants can help them to cope with everyday life after discharge from a neonatal intensive care unit. Background: Premature children are at higher risk for physical and mental health problems, which makes parenting demanding. The transition between hospital and home is a challenging period where parents may need extra support to cope with everyday life. Method: Nine mothers of premature infants receiving follow-up care at a health center especially adapted for families with premature infants were interviewed. L’ambiente d’apprendimento nella prima infanzia alla luce della prospettiva Montessoriana: un’indagine in Sicilia

2019

The following paper focus on the growing interest in structuring the learning environment in order to promote the psycho-social-attitudinal development of the infant. The montessorian approach enhances a child-friendly environment. It facilitates active participation in the child’s daily life, thus contributing towards a higher level of independence, self-awareness, self-esteem and self-evaluation. The survey conducted in June 2019 shows that in Sicily less people are adopting montessorian approach nowadays into the early childhood structures.

Revista española de orientación y psicopedagogía

2002

Resumen tomado del autor Se describe el programa de intervención psicoeducativa aplicado a un niño de educación infantil afectado por un tumor intracraneal : astrocitoma cerebeloso. Esta intervención se realizó durante el curso 2000-2001, tres horas semanales, en el domicilio familiar, en horario extraescolar, y con la colaboración de la maestra del niño. El objetivo de este trabajo es destacar la importancia de aplicar un programa de intervención psicoeducativa adaptado a la enfermedad del niño, con la finalidad de evitar problemas que pueden afectar a su desarrollo personal y escolar.
